hi soravp, and welcome to sevenforums,

you don't mention the cpu in your system specs, some research shows that it's an intel core 2 duo t6600 - not the latest and greatest, but it's no slouch.

do you have a lot of stuff starting up at boot-time?

type msconfig into your start-menu searchbox - have a look at the startup tab, and ask yourself if you really need all that running on your system in the background. also check the services tab, hide the microsoft services, and ask yourself whether you need the rest.

essential things to keep are antivirus/malware scanners and gadgets that you actually use.

try disabling a few things at a time, rebooting, and making sure everything works as it should. with any luck, you'll lighten your computer's load, and hopefully claw back some performance.

visit the hp website and make sure all your drivers are up to date too, although you may have already.
